What is the difference between morals and values?

‘Morals’ are the standards of the behavior or principle of beliefs of an individual to judge what is right and wrong These are often developed and later governed as per the societal expectations ‘Values’ on the other hand is the learned belief system where an individual motivates themself to do several things

What is the difference between morals and ethics?

According to this understanding, “ethics” leans towards decisions based upon individual character, and the more subjective understanding of right and wrong by individuals – whereas “morals” emphasises the widely-shared communal or societal norms about right and wrong

What affects good ethical conduct?

Individual, social, and opportunity factors all affect the level of ethical behavior in an organization Individual factors include knowledge level, moral values and attitudes, and personal goals Social factors include cultural norms and the actions and values of coworkers and significant others

What are the factors that affect moral behavior?

Moral development is strongly influenced by interpersonal factors, such as family, peers, and culture Intrapersonal factors also impact moral development, such as cognitive changes, emotions, and even neurodevelopment

What are the ways of encouraging ethical behavior?

Fostering Ethical Decisions

  • Act ethically and be seen to act ethically
  • Be active in the ethics program For example, introduce the ethics training or be the person to speak
  • Encourage employees to raise issues
  • Address ethics issues
  • Enforce the ethics program, such as by punishing violators
